Casio EX-100 has external dimensions of 119x67x50 mm and weighs 389 g (including batteries). Fujifilm XP150 has external dimensions of 103 x 71 x 27 mm (4.06 x 2.8 x 1.06″) and weighs 205 g (0.45 lb / 7.23 oz) (including batteries).
Below you can see the front-view size comparison of the Casio EX-100 and the Fujifilm XP150. Fujifilm XP150 is 16mm narrower and 23mm thinner than Casio EX-100 but it is also 4mm taller.

Weight is another important factor, especially when deciding on a camera that you want to carry with you all day.
Fujifilm XP150 is significantly lighter (184g ) than the Casio EX-100 which may become a big advantage especially on long walking trips.

LCD Screen Size and Features
Casio EX-100's 3.50" LCD screen is slightly larger than Fujifilm XP150's 2.7" screen.
In addition to the size advantage, Casio EX-100 LCD screen also has a
Tilting feature where you can change the angle of the screen to make it easier to shoot from waist or over-the-head levels. On the other hand, Fujifilm XP150 has a fixed type screen which provides less flexibility in shooting positions compared to EX-100.
